Ska (/skɑː/; Jamaican: [skjæ]) can be a music genre that originated in Jamaica during the late 1950s and was the precursor to rocksteady and reggae.[one] It combined elements of Caribbean mento and calypso with American jazz and rhythm and blues. Ska is characterized by a walking bass line accented with rhythms to the off beat.

From the mid-1960s, ska gave rise to rocksteady, a genre slower than ska featuring more romantic lyrics and less outstanding horns.[37] Theories abound as to why Jamaican musicians slowed the ska tempo to create rocksteady; a person is that the singer Hopeton Lewis was unable to sing his hit song "Take It Easy" at a ska tempo.

Along with the rise of ska came the popularity of deejays such as Sir Lord Comic, King Stitt and pioneer Count Matchuki, who started talking stylistically over the rhythms of popular songs at sound systems. In Jamaican music, the Deejay would be the one who talks (known elsewhere because the MC) along with the selector could be the person who chooses the records.

During the mid-20th century, mento was conflated with calypso, and mento was commonly often called calypso, kalypso and mento calypso; mento singers usually used calypso songs and techniques.
